yes sometimes I feel pretty dumb asking a question as the answer might be too easy…

but I just want to be sure….

Here is one about dosing:

I do use tropic marin balling and need to dose the following:

50ml per 100litre raises Alk by 1,4 dKh

I dose 28ml for my 200litres and that should raise Alk by 0.4 dKh~

If I would switch to Modern Reef I need:

10ml per 100 litres raises Alk by 1,0 dKH

So, do I need to dose 8ml to raise Alk by 0.4 dKh for 200litres??
